The Nifty 50 trading plan today on 6 August 2026 centres on a key technical question: can the index defend the 24,500 level amid likely consolidation in today session? The Nifty 50 trading plan today is shaped by a market that closed flat (approximately 24,590) on 5 August 2026 following the RBI rate hold at 5.25 percent, with mixed sectoral signals and today session expected to see cautious trading ahead of SBI Q1 FY27 results and weekly options expiry. A decisive move above 24,800 in the Nifty 50 trading plan today could open the path toward the 25,000 mark, while the 24,500 to 24,400 zone is the critical support band to watch if selling emerges.

Nifty 50 Trading Plan Today: Bull vs Bear Scenario

In the Nifty 50 trading plan today, the bull scenario requires a decisive close above 24,800, which could attract momentum traders and open a move toward the psychologically important 25,000 mark. A decisive breakout in the Nifty 50 trading plan today above 24,800 would represent a meaningful shift in short-term trend and could be accompanied by a broader rally in mid and small caps, where valuations have run up significantly. Nifty Smallcap 100 has been at fresh peaks, and a Nifty 50 trading plan today bull breakout could add further fuel to the broader market.

In the bear scenario for the Nifty 50 trading plan today, a break below 24,500 would open the 24,400 zone as the next key support. Investors and traders using the Nifty 50 trading plan today should note that the weekly options expiry on 6 August 2026 can cause amplified moves in either direction, particularly around key strikes like 24,500 and 24,800.

Bank Nifty in the Trading Plan Today: 57,300 as Key Level

The Nifty Bank element of the Nifty 50 trading plan today has its own critical level at 57,300. The Nifty Bank closed at approximately 57,720 on 5 August 2026 after a session where private banks declined 1.1 percent. In the Nifty 50 trading plan today, a Bank Nifty hold above 57,300 would be needed to prevent further deterioration in the index. A breach of 57,300 in Bank Nifty, especially if SBI Q1 FY27 results disappoint, could add downward pressure to the Nifty 50 trading plan today overall market direction.

SBI Q1 FY27 results being announced today on 6 August 2026 will be the single biggest stock-specific catalyst for the Nifty 50 trading plan today, given SBI weight in the Nifty and the banking sector broader direction.
